The fight against inflation in P2E games

The advent of blockchain games, working on the principle of P2E, revealed the problem of inflation that has long existed in classic games. The difference, however, is that now this inflation is much more difficult to disguise — the situation with it is visible in stock reports.

At the same time, many contradictions were inherent in the process. For example, an online game must, by definition, create some resources out of thin air, this is essentially its direct task — to create game value for things that have no objective value. And this is a disaster in the language of economics. The second important point is that the game always works with the irrational behavior of the player. And it is rather strange to expect from the player that he will simultaneously behave irrationally, making an impulsive purchase, and then the same player will become rational and calmly take losses, getting rid of the unnecessary and lost in the value of the asset.

It is also a curious fact that even if not originally intended to participate in the market speculation, game values will always do so, since the free possibility of reselling allows you to play with them in the “Greater fool”, which for many is a much more interesting game than the one that developers offer to play.

The consequences of the temporary hype and subsequent inevitable inflation are very unfortunate — a game in which an interesting economy that motivates players to do something useful, gain new experience, etc., remains with the economy killed by a jump in the hype. At the same time, it can no longer be saved by the methods adopted in classic games since the blockchain inherently implies some restrictions for manipulation by developers.

Considering the given restrictions and a need for a high degree of reliability, one of the possible solutions is the Wipe Threat. Wipe is needed to guarantee the destruction of the savings of the most thrifty players. There will always be such players, and blockchain restrictions make it impossible to clean up these reserves, except to untie the game tokens themselves from the game. At the same time, as we remember, the ideology of a regular wipe does not suit us for the reasons described in the corresponding paragraph, so we need to find the correct mechanism for launching a wipe. Ideally, a wipe should be possible, but there is also a chance it will not happen soon enough or happen at all.

Obviously, in such a situation, it is impossible to give the control of the wipe to either the developers or the DAO, since on the one hand, it will create a point where players can put pressure on it, and it will also strongly centralize the management of the game. The ideal option here would be to give a choice to players and not in the form of a regular vote, but in the form of a set of actions, each of which adds or removes the wipe approach.

We, as developers, set some criteria for a fun game that we have chosen and create mechanisms that infinitely push back the wipe if the current state of the game meets these criteria, or vice versa, bring the wipe closer and launch if the game does not meet them.

For example, we bring the wipe moment closer if the accumulation of players is above some line. And we’re also pushing back the wipe if players are engaging in some activity that should be burning game resources.

Thus, if the majority of players endlessly accumulate resources, they will quickly be punished by a wipe and lose all their progress. But if the community of players burns resources in various activities, then the game can exist within one session for an infinitely long time.
